如何使 jQuery 可排序插件与列表一起工作
How to make jQuery sortable plugin working with list
我正在尝试将 this jQuery sortable plugin 放入我的 bootstrap 列表组项目中。我只想放正常的 drag-drop/sortable 选项,没有 effect/animation。这就是为什么,我只是像这样制作我的代码:
HTML:
<ul class="list-group item-list">
<li class="list-group-item">Item 1</li>
<li class="list-group-item">Item 2</li>
<li class="list-group-item">Item 3</li>
</ul>
<ul class="list-group item-list">
</ul>
jQuery:
$('.item-list').sortable();
但是,它无法将项目从第一个 ul.item-list
丢弃到第二个 ul.item-list
!如何让它发挥作用?
看来您需要的不仅仅是调用 .sortable()?
这个例子似乎做了你想做的,他们使用 ol 而不是 ul 标签和 li 项目
http://johnny.github.io/jquery-sortable/#connected
然后简单地"show code"得到例子
*******更新*********
工作代码:
$('.item-list').sortable({
group: 'list-group',
pullPlaceholder: false,
});
我正在尝试将 this jQuery sortable plugin 放入我的 bootstrap 列表组项目中。我只想放正常的 drag-drop/sortable 选项,没有 effect/animation。这就是为什么,我只是像这样制作我的代码:
HTML:
<ul class="list-group item-list">
<li class="list-group-item">Item 1</li>
<li class="list-group-item">Item 2</li>
<li class="list-group-item">Item 3</li>
</ul>
<ul class="list-group item-list">
</ul>
jQuery:
$('.item-list').sortable();
但是,它无法将项目从第一个 ul.item-list
丢弃到第二个 ul.item-list
!如何让它发挥作用?
看来您需要的不仅仅是调用 .sortable()?
这个例子似乎做了你想做的,他们使用 ol 而不是 ul 标签和 li 项目
http://johnny.github.io/jquery-sortable/#connected
然后简单地"show code"得到例子
*******更新*********
工作代码:
$('.item-list').sortable({
group: 'list-group',
pullPlaceholder: false,
});